What you will need

This recipe uses 8 simple ingredients that you can find at any grocery store:

  • 2 cans pure pumpkin puree
  • 1 can full-fat coconut milk
  • 2 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 medium yellow onion diced
  • 2 teaspoons pumpkin pie spice
  • 1 teaspoon ground coriander
  • 2 tablespoons maple syrup
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il

Step by step instructions

Step 1: Saute the Onion

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the diced onion and cook for 5 minutes until soft and translucent. Stir in the pumpkin pie spice and coriander and cook for 1 minute.

Step 2: Add Pumpkin and Liquid

Add the pumpkin puree, vegetable broth, and coconut milk to the pot. Stir everything together until well combined.

Step 3: Simmer and Flavor

Bring the soup to a gentle simmer over medium heat. Stir in the maple syrup and simmer for 15 minutes to allow the flavors to deepen and meld together.

Step 4: Blend Until Smooth

Use an immersion blender to blend the soup until completely smooth and creamy. Season generously with salt and pepper to taste.

Step 5: Serve

Ladle into bowls and garnish with a swirl of coconut cream, toasted pepitas, and a light dusting of cinnamon.

Easy substitutions

Missing an ingredient? Here are some swaps that work perfectly:

  • pumpkin puree → butternut squash puree or sweet potato puree for a similar sweet and creamy result
  • pumpkin pie spice → a combination of cinnamon, nutmeg, and cloves measured to taste

Common mistakes to avoid

Watch out for these pitfalls that can affect your results:

  • Using pumpkin pie filling instead of plain pumpkin puree which adds unwanted sweetness and excess sugar
  • Forgetting to season with enough salt which leaves the soup tasting bland despite all the spices

Nutrition facts

Per serving: 230 calories, 5g protein, 32g carbs, 11g fat, 6g fiber.
